Vaultwarden versions prior to 1.35.5 contain a vulnerability where refresh tokens are not invalidated after certain security-sensitive user actions, such as password changes or key rotations. This allows an attacker with a previously obtained refresh token to maintain session access despite the user attempting to secure their account. The issue is identified as insufficient session expiration (CWE-613) and has a CVSS score of 6.8 (medium severity). The vulnerability is fixed in version 1.35.5.
